Envestnet Asset Management Inc. Raises Stock Holdings in Enerpac Tool Group Corp. (NYSE:EPAC)

Enerpac Tool Group logo with Industrials background

Envestnet Asset Management Inc. raised its holdings in shares of Enerpac Tool Group Corp. (NYSE:EPAC - Free Report) by 1,018.1%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 142,267 shares of the company's stock after purchasing an additional 129,543 shares during the period. Envestnet Asset Management Inc. owned 0.26% of Enerpac Tool Group worth $5,846,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Other large investors have also recently made changes to their positions in the company. Barclays PLC increased its stake in Enerpac Tool Group by 321.7% during the 3rd quarter. Barclays PLC now owns 107,979 shares of the company's stock valued at $4,524,000 after purchasing an additional 82,376 shares in the last qu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C raised its holdings in Enerpac Tool Group by 1.7% in the 3rd qu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C now owns 1,236,259 shares of the company's stock worth $51,797,000 after acquiring an additional 21,056 shares during the last quarter. SkyView Investment Advisors LLC raised its holdings in Enerpac Tool Group by 1.6% in the 3rd quarter. SkyView Investment Advisors LLC now owns 17,014 shares of the company's stock worth $713,000 after acquiring an additional 276 shares during the last quarter. Tidal Investments LLC lifted its position in Enerpac Tool Group by 17.8% in the 3rd quarter. Tidal Investments LLC now owns 18,419 shares of the company's stock valued at $772,000 after acquiring an additional 2,780 shares in the last quarter. Finally, Principal Financial Group Inc. boosted its stake in Enerpac Tool Group by 2.9% during the 3rd quarter. Principal Financial Group Inc. now owns 277,494 shares of the company's stock valued at $11,624,000 after purchasing an additional 7,845 shares during the last quarter. 97.70% of the stock is currently ow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

Enerpac Tool Group Stock Performance

Enerpac Tool Group stock traded down $0.04 during midday trading on Friday, reaching $40.10. 85,069 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 331,647. Enerpac Tool Group Corp. has a 12 month low of $35.12 and a 12 month high of $51.91.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.47, a current ratio of 2.92 and a quick ratio of 2.24. The business has a 50 day moving average of $42.95 and a two-hundred day moving average of $44.44. The firm has a market capitalization of $2.17 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 24.40 and a beta of 1.08.

Enerpac Tool Group (NYSE:EPAC -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Monday, March 24th. The company reported $0.39 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, hitting analysts' consensus estimates of $0.39. Enerpac Tool Group had a return on equity of 25.39% and a net margin of 15.14%. The firm had revenue of $145.53 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$139.80 million. As a group, research analysts predict that Enerpac Tool Group Corp. will post 1.78 earnings per share for the current year.

Enerpac Tool Group Profile

(Free Report)

Enerpac Tool Group Corp. manufactures and sells a range of industrial products and solutions in the United States, the United Kingdom, Germany, Australia, Canada, China, Saudi Arabia, Brazil, France, and internationally. It operates through Industrial Tools & Services and Other segments. The Industrial Tools & Services segment designs, manufactures, and distributes branded hydraulic and mechanical tools; and provides services and tool rentals to the infrastructure, industrial maintenance, repair and operations, oil and gas, mining, alternative and renewable energy, civil construction, and other markets.
